Tesla Faces Consecutive Sales Decline Despite Price Cuts

As competition intensifies and model lineup ages, Tesla's sales drop for the second quarter in a row.

  • Tesla's global deliveries fell by 4.8% in Q2, following a similar decline in Q1.
  • The company struggles with an aging product lineup and increased competition, particularly in China.
  • Experts suggest Tesla needs new or updated models to rejuvenate its sales.
  • Price cuts and low-interest financing have not significantly boosted demand.
  • Overall U.S. new vehicle sales rose marginally, with high prices deterring many buyers.
